- + P A

- Windows 2003中如何安全的释放内存

      我的日志 2006-11-20 22:21
  经常看到有朋友在论坛上诉苦说需要释放内存,其实如果你安装了Windows 2003的话,那么并不需要寻求那些需要注册才能长久使用的第三方内存管理软件。因为Windows 2003已经自带了一个名为Empty.exe的小程序,它可以用来释放某些应用程序在占用大量内存时不能及时释放的那部分资源,与那些第三方软件内存管理软件不同的是, Empty.exe不会强迫系统全部释放资源,而是仅仅释放必要的资源,这样就不会加重硬盘的负担了。

  Empty.exe的使用相当简单,命令格式如下:

  Empty.exe pid(pid指进程的product id)

  或者是Empty.exe ta
...
标签集:TAGS:
我要留言To Comment 阅读全文Read All | 回复Comments() 点击Count()

- Windows操作系统出现内存错误怎么办?

      我的日志 2006-11-20 22:20
  使用Windows操作系统的人有时会遇到这样的错误信息:“0X????????指令引用的0x00000000内存,该内存不能written”,然后应用程序被关闭。如果去请教一些“高手”,得到的回答往往是“Windows就是这样不稳定”之类的义愤和不屑。其实,这个错误并不一定是Windows不稳定造成的。本文就来简单分析这种错误的常见原因。
 一、应用程序没有检查内存分配失败

 程序需要一块内存用以保存数据时,就需要调用操作系统提供的“功能函数”来申请,如果内存分配成功,函数就会将所新开辟的内存区地址返回给应用程序,应用
...
标签集:TAGS:计算机 IT 电脑
我要留言To Comment 阅读全文Read All | 回复Comments() 点击Count()

- WinXP系统文件保护功能介绍

      我的日志 2006-11-20 22:19
  当你安装一个应用程序却不料引起Windows崩溃的时候,很有可能是因为应用程序改写了关键的Windows系统文件,导致系统崩溃。在文件被修改后,结果往往不可预知。系统可能正常运行,或者出一些错误,或者完全崩溃。幸运的是,Windows 2000, XP,和Server 2003应用了一个称作Windows文件保护(Windows File Protection, WFP)机制,它可以防止关键的系统文件被改写。在这篇文章中,我将解释何谓WFP和它是如何工作的。我还要告诉你如何修改或忽略WFP的行为。(注释:尽管在Windows 2000, XP,和Server 2003上,WFP的运行没什么区别,但这篇文章中的信息,包括注册表相关条目和SFC语法, ...
标签集:TAGS:计算机 IT 电脑
我要留言To Comment 阅读全文Read All | 回复Comments() 点击Count()

- 解决BT与浏览网页在SP2中的冲突

      我的日志 2006-11-20 22:19
  你是否是P2P狂人,您是否也因为看重系统的安全性能而安装了最新的SP2呢,那我想,最近您在用BT软件下载那些宝贵资源的时候恐怕遇到了小小的麻烦,您的系统是否会在进行BT下载的时候而无法打开网页或者网页打开得非常慢了呢?笔者自从装了SP2以后,就一直为这个问题烦恼着。最后迫不得已删除了SP2(没办法,BT上的那些最新大片啊,难以割舍)。一次偶然的机会,在看关于SP2特性的文章中了解到,原来微软出于安全方面的考虑,在SP2当中限制了TCP并发连接数。根本原因是因为Service Pack 2实时监控每一个进程的并发线程数目,只要超过了它认为的安全线程数目就开始蔽屏掉部分线程。这是为了防止震荡波这类的蠕虫病毒,但是bt、emule这类的多线程的点对点工 ...
标签集:TAGS:计算机 IT 电脑
我要留言To Comment 阅读全文Read All | 回复Comments() 点击Count()

- 简单实用 Linux操作系统三则超酷技巧

      我的日志 2006-11-20 22:17
  Linux下修改MAC地址

 MAC地址是网卡的物理地址,在Windows系统下,我们可以通过修改注册表的方法,骗过系统,修改MAC地址。其实在Linux下也可更改MAC地址:

  1.关闭网卡设备
  /sbin/ifconfig eth0 down

  2.修改MAC地址
  /sbin/ifconfig eth0 hw ether MAC地址

  3.重启网卡
  /sbin/ifconfig eth0 up(河北 李顺)

 让普通用户安全执行管理员程序

 在多人共用一台电脑或管理
...
标签集:TAGS:计算机 IT 电脑
我要留言To Comment 阅读全文Read All | 回复Comments() 点击Count()

- 如何在多台电脑上同时安装Windows

      我的日志 2006-11-20 22:16
  第一步,在一台工作站上安装Norton Ghost 7.5企业版(含网络多播GhostCast Server软件)。
        第二步,创建安装模板。在这台计算机上安装Windows操作系统(其他操作系统可作相应调整),还可以安装各种应用程序,并对整个系统进行适当的设置和调整。
        第三步,使用Ghost制作模板计算机的磁盘映像文件。
        第四步,安装多播服务器。在Windows系统环境下,从Symantec Ghost程序组中找到一个名为“GhostCas
...
标签集:TAGS:计算机 IT 电脑
我要留言To Comment 阅读全文Read All | 回复Comments() 点击Count()

- 服务器配置SSL

      我的日志 2006-11-20 22:16
  颁发证书

1.从“管理工具”程序组中启动“证书颁发机构”工具。
2.展开您的证书颁发机构,然后选择“挂起的申请”文件夹。
3.选择刚才提交的证书申请。
4.在“操作”菜单中,指向“所有任务”,然后单击“颁发”。
5.确认该证书显示在“颁发的证书”文件夹中,然后双击查看它。
6.在“详细信息”选项卡中,单击“复制到文件”,将证书保存为 Base-64 编
...
标签集:TAGS:计算机 IT 电脑
我要留言To Comment 阅读全文Read All | 回复Comments() 点击Count()

- 在Win2000中预防Ping攻击

      我的日志 2006-11-20 22:15
  在Win2000中如何关闭ICMP(Ping)

 ICMP的全名是Internet Control and Message Protocal即因特网控制消息/错误报文协议,这个协议主要是用来进行错误信息和控制信息的传递,例如著名的Ping和Tracert工具都是利用ICMP协议中的ECHO request报文进行的(请求报文ICMP ECHO类型8代码0,应答报文ICMP ECHOREPLY类型0代码0)。

 ICMP协议有一个特点---它是无连结的,也就是说只要发送端完成ICMP报文的封装并传递给路由器,这个报文将会象邮包一样自己去寻找目的地址,这个特点使得ICMP协议非常灵活快捷,但是同时也带来
...
标签集:TAGS:计算机 IT 电脑
我要留言To Comment 阅读全文Read All | 回复Comments() 点击Count()

- 在Windows XP系统中禁止修改文件属性

      我的日志 2006-11-20 22:14
  笔者是一名计算机机房管理员,机房的微机使用的是Windows XP连网。由于上机的学生比较多,使用的人特别杂,他们经常修改文件的属性,给机房管理带来了极大的不便。为了解决这个问题,我们可以禁止用户在资源管理器中对文件或者文件夹的属性进行更改,具体方法是:
 选择“开始→运行→REGEDIT”,打开注册表编辑器,找到或新建“HKEY_CURRENT_USER\Software\Microsoft\Windows \CurrentVersion\Policies\Explorer”或“HKEY_LOCAL_Machine\Software\Microsoft\
...
标签集:TAGS:计算机 IT 电脑
我要留言To Comment 阅读全文Read All | 回复Comments() 点击Count()

- 初学者入门:FreeBSD系统的安装与优化

      我的日志 2006-11-20 22:14
  对于许多电脑用户来说,FreeBSD还是一个比较陌生的系统。本文将以FreeBSD 4.7 Release为例,一步一步地带您安装一份完整的FreeBSD操作系统。
 安装前的准备

 FreeBSD对于系统的硬件适应能力比较强(相比Linux可能稍差,特别是对于新的显示卡的支持;但对于服务器常用的硬件,包括SCSI设备的支持是相当完善的)。IA平台的多数处理器,下至386,上至Pentium-4及其兼容的CPU,都能够运行FreeBSD。

 为了有效地安装、运行FreeBSD,我个人推荐安装FreeBSD的系统至少要有2GB的剩余硬盘空间,以及至少64MB内存。这样配置的电脑在今天是很容
...
标签集:TAGS:计算机 IT 电脑
我要留言To Comment 阅读全文Read All | 回复Comments() 点击Count()

- Qmail邮件队列工作原理

      我的日志 2006-11-14 21:3
1.概述
以下是qmail的数据流简图

qmail-smtpd --- >>qmail-queue --->> qmail-send <<--- qmail-rspawn <<--- qmail-remote
/ |
qmail-inject _/ qmail-clean \_ qmail-lspawn <<--- qmail-local

qmail中,每一条消息都发送到中央队列等待发送,由qmail-queue进程控制。它在以下情况被调用:
1、当产生本地消息时,qmail-inject进程调用qmail-queue。
...
标签集:TAGS:计算机 IT 网络
我要留言To Comment 阅读全文Read All | 回复Comments() 点击Count()

- Apache1.3.22主要改进及修正

      我的日志 2006-11-14 21:2
Apache 1.3.21将永远不会发布了; 本文包括在1.3.21和1.3.22中累积下来的改进。
这个版本的Apache主要修正了一个可能用目录列表代替缺省主页而导致的安全漏洞问题。
Apache 1.3.20 - 1.3.22主要改进:

安全弱点:
1。在Apache1.3.20的win32平台上发现了一个漏洞。如果客户端发送一个非常长的URI可能导致用目录列表来代替缺省主页。403 Forbidden将被返回。CAN-2001-0729
2。在split-logfile支持程序中发现了一个漏洞。用特别的Host:头标发送的请求可能会允许系统中任一个以.log扩展名结尾的文件被写入。PR#7848
...
标签集:TAGS:计算机 IT 网络
我要留言To Comment 阅读全文Read All | 回复Comments() 点击Count()

- RedHat7.1下安装Oracle8.1.7.0.1全过程

      我的日志 2006-11-14 21:1
需要的软件:
oracle81701.tar
compat-glibc-6.2-2.1.3.2.i386.rpm(2.14MB)
compat-libs-6.2-3.i386.rpm(1.36MB)
compat-egcs-6.2-1.1.2.14.i386.rpm(943KB)
IBMJava118-SD.-1.1.8-5.0.i386.rpm(10.5MB)
setup_group.sh
env_ctx.mk
root.sh
glibc-2.1.3-stubs.tar.gz

步骤:
⑴root身份在RedHat7.1光盘disc1
...
标签集:TAGS:计算机 IT 网络
我要留言To Comment 阅读全文Read All | 回复Comments() 点击Count()

- 防火墙分析报告

      我的日志 2006-11-14 21:0
以前对防火墙接触甚少,所了解的也是从系统底层实现角度看的一些分析细节,最近由于工作需要,对防火墙的发展、分类、现状和趋向等方面做了概略的了解,也有一些体会,做个简单的总结。

第一部分,防火墙的基本概念

  首先说明一些文中大量用到的概念:
外网(非受信网络):防火墙外的网络,一般为Internet;
内网(受信网络):防火墙内的网络;
受信主机和非受信主机分别对照内网和外网的主机。
非军事化区(DMZ):为了配置管理方便,内网中需要向外提供服务的服务器往往放在一个单独的网段,这个网段便是非军事化区。防火墙一般配备三块网卡,在配置时一般分别分别连接内部网,Internet和
...
标签集:TAGS:计算机 IT 网络
我要留言To Comment 阅读全文Read All | 回复Comments() 点击Count()

- 在Linux中访问MSSQL(PHP版)

      我的日志 2006-11-14 20:59

Linux——IBM PC SERVER 330, RedHat 6.2,Apache 1.3.20 + PHP 4.0.6
Win2k Server——DELL 4400, SQL SERVER 7.0
任务:公司图书馆的数据库系统采用MSSQL,WEB服务器我选了LINUX(硬件老啊),为了给全体职工提供在线图书查询,需要在LINUX中增加PHP模块,访问MSSQL。
解决过程:
找啊找啊找啊找,找到下面这篇E文,很好,居然一把搞定。
但是,我仔细看了PHP 4.X给的E文MANUAL,发现PHP是有MSSQL数据库访问支持的,那就是用它的DBX,如果你成功安装了下面的Freetds,你可以这

...
标签集:TAGS:计算机 IT 网络
我要留言To Comment 阅读全文Read All | 回复Comments() 点击Count()